We are a not-for-profit NGO based in Kathmandu, working in rural communities of Nepal.

Our mission is to empower marginalized communities through equitable, inclusive and holistic development programs. There are four pillars in our developmental approach: Education, Health & Environment, Economy and Basic infrastructure development. These four pillars of development are supported by six major community empowerment programs namely Women’s Empowerment, Children’s Development, Youth Empowerment, Public Health & Medical care, Environment Conservation and Disaster Risk Reduction. All VIN’s developmental and humanitarian programs are aligned with U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s).

Job Description

VC is responsible to coordinate with international & local volunteers. VC represents VIN’s Vvalues and mission, and is responsible for effectively integrating the skills and experiences of international volunteers with the knowledge and vision of the local team. This includes everything necessary to ensure the effective settling of volunteers, such that they are able to contribute to the best of their abilities. Logistic Support like, airport pick up, accommodation booking, orientation / training, placement, arranging host families, follow up support, transportation, planning & reporting.
